Constitutive Rules
are principles that not only regulate but also define forms of activity, such as the
Rules of chess
that establish what it means to
Play the game
. These rules are foundational in creating the possibility of
New activities
and
Forms of social reality
, transforming otherwise
Meaningless actions
into structured,
Identifiable practices
.
